How to Make Asparagus Stuffed Chicken Breast

Step 1: Preheat and Prep

Begin by preheating your oven to 400°F (200°C). While the oven is heating, grab your asparagus and trim the tough ends. This prep work saves time and ensures every bite of the Asparagus Stuffed Chicken Breast is perfectly tender.

Step 2: Create Chicken Pockets

Lay the chicken breasts flat on a cutting board. With a sharp knife, carefully slice a pocket into each one, cutting lengthwise but making sure not to go all the way through. This pocket is where all the magic (and filling) will happen!

Step 3: Season Inside and Out

Sprinkle garlic powder, paprika, salt, and pepper generously—don’t forget the inside of each pocket! Seasoning both inside and out helps every layer come alive with flavor, so no bland bites here.

Step 4: Stuff With Asparagus and Cheese

Tuck three asparagus spears and about 1/4 cup of shredded mozzarella into the pocket of each chicken breast. The crisp green spears paired with melty cheese make for the most delicious, colorful filling. Secure each stuffed chicken breast closed with toothpicks or a loop of kitchen twine.

Step 5: Sear for Golden Goodness

Heat the olive oil in a large, oven-safe skillet over medium-high heat. Add the stuffed chicken and sear each side for 3 to 4 minutes until beautifully golden. This quick step ensures you have savory, caramelized edges on your Asparagus Stuffed Chicken Breast.

Step 6: Bake Until Perfectly Juicy

Transfer the skillet to your preheated oven. Bake for 15 to 18 minutes, or until the chicken reaches an internal temperature of 165°F (74°C). This guarantees tender, juicy chicken every time. Don’t forget to carefully remove the toothpicks before serving!

How to Serve Asparagus Stuffed Chicken Breast

Garnishes

A sprinkle of fresh chopped parsley, a dusting of extra paprika, or a drizzle of lemon juice helps refresh and balance the richness of the Asparagus Stuffed Chicken Breast. Fresh herbs and citrus liven up the plate and impress your senses before the first bite.

Side Dishes

Pair your Asparagus Stuffed Chicken Breast with simple roasted potatoes, a quinoa pilaf, or a crisp garden salad for a satisfying meal. If you want to keep it extra light, opt for a cauliflower puree or garlicky sautéed green beans.

Creative Ways to Present

Try slicing the stuffed chicken into rounds to reveal the gorgeous layers of green and cheese before fanning them out on a platter. Topping each piece with a small dollop of pesto or sun-dried tomato tapenade adds both color and flavor for a dish that looks straight out of a gourmet kitchen.

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

Cool any remaining Asparagus Stuffed Chicken Breast to room temperature, then transfer to an airtight container. Store in the refrigerator for up to 3 days for fresh flavor and texture.

Freezing

You can freeze fully cooked chicken breasts for busy nights! Wrap each Asparagus Stuffed Chicken Breast tightly in plastic wrap, then place in a freezer-safe bag or container. They’ll keep beautifully for up to 2 months. Thaw overnight in the fridge before reheating.

Reheating

For best results, gently reheat stuffed chicken in a 325°F (165°C) oven covered with foil until warmed through. This method preserves both flavor and moisture, so your leftovers are almost as good as fresh!

FAQs

Can I use a different cheese instead of mozzarella?

Absolutely! Provolone and Swiss melt beautifully and add their own flavor twist. Even a sharp white cheddar will work great for a more robust taste.

What’s the best way to keep the stuffing from falling out?

Securing the pocket with toothpicks or kitchen twine is key. Just make sure the opening is as snug as possible, and remember to remove all toothpicks before serving!

How do I know when the chicken is cooked all the way?

Use a food thermometer—once the thickest part of your Asparagus Stuffed Chicken Breast reaches 165°F (74°C), it’s perfectly safe and juicy. Baking time may vary slightly based on thickness.

Can I prepare this dish ahead of time?

Yes! You can assemble and stuff the chicken breasts several hours in advance. Keep them covered in the fridge until ready to sear and bake, making dinnertime a breeze.

What if I don’t have an oven-safe skillet?

No worries! After searing, carefully transfer the seared stuffed chicken breasts to a baking dish lined with a drizzle of oil before popping them in the oven.

Ingredients

Units Scale

For the Chicken:

  • 4 boneless skinless chicken breasts
  • 12 asparagus spears (trimmed)
  • 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on paprika
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• toothpicks or kitchen twine

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ven: Pre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C).
  2. Prepare the chicken: Slice a pocket into each chicken breast. Season with garlic powder, paprika, salt, and pepper.
  3. Stuff the chicken: Fill each chicken breast with asparagus and mozzarella. Secure with toothpicks or twine.
  4. Sear the chicken: Sear the chicken in a skillet until golden.
  5. Bake: Transfer the skillet to the oven and bake until cooked through.
  6. Serve: Remove toothpicks before serving.
